What are some adaptations polar bears have developed for survival in the tundra?

Black skin to better absorb sun rays to help stay warm also fat/blubber to keep body temp warm/stable

Answer: Some adaptations that polar bear have to survive easily in tundra region are:

They have two layers of fur. Both the fur have different colors. One of the fur is white in color so that the bears can easily camouflage with the white snow that is present in the tundra region.

They have a layer of fat on their body which helps them to survive in colder region.

They hide in caves during the time of pregnancy to protect their children from danger.
